J has read 160 pages in a book. This is 4/5 of the entire book. How many pages does the book have?

Let x be the number of pages in the book.
We know that 4/5 of the book's entire length is 160 pages, so 4/5 * x = 160.
Multiplying both sides of the equation by 5/4, we get x = 200 pages.
Therefore, the book has 200 pages. Answer: \boxed{200}.
S is twice as old as B. In 5 years, the sum of their ages will be 25 years. Find their present ages.
Let's assume B's present age is x.
Therefore, S's present age is 2x, as S is twice as old as B.
In 5 years, B's age will be x + 5, and S's age will be 2x + 5.
According to the problem, the sum of their ages in 5 years will be 25 years.
So, we have the equation x + 5 + 2x + 5 = 25.
Combining like terms, we get 3x + 10 = 25.
Subtracting 10 from both sides of the equation, we get 3x = 15.
Dividing both sides of the equation by 3, we get x = 5.
So, B's present age is x = 5 years.
And S's present age is 2x = 2 * 5 = 10 years.
Therefore, B is 5 years old and S is 10 years old. Answer: \boxed{5, 10}.
A rectangle is 15 cm wide. Find the area and perimeter of the rectangle if it’s width is 3/5 of its length.
Let's assume the length of the rectangle is x cm.
Given that the width is 3/5 of the length, we have the equation:
Width = 3/5 * Length
15cm = 3/5 * x
Multiplying both sides of the equation by 5/3, we get:
x = 15cm * 5/3
x = 25cm
So, the length of the rectangle is 25 cm.
The area of a rectangle is given by the formula A = length * width.
Therefore, the area of the rectangle is:
A = 25cm * 15cm
A = 375 cm^2

The perimeter of a rectangle is given by the formula P = 2 * (length + width).
Therefore, the perimeter of the rectangle is:
P = 2 * (25 cm + 15 cm)
P = 2 * 40 cm
P = 80 cm

Therefore, the area of the rectangle is 375 cm^2 and the perimeter is 80 cm. Answer: \boxed{375 \, \text{cm}^2, 80 \, \text{cm}}.
